Document Batch Loading

March 17, 2007 on 12:49 pm | In iQuickdoc, Micro ISV, Micro ISV in India | No Comments

iQuickdoc is slowly and steadily moving towards its upcoming release. The latest feature to get in are

Batch uploading of documents

You can now point to a folder and voila the entire folder contents will be uploaded into the project you choose. The entire folder tree can now be uploaded using this new batch upload utility.

iQuickdoc backup

The back up utility now provides full folder support, helping you to download the entire iQuickdoc projects and their content on to the file system. Helping you easily do maintenance or system changes. You can later use the bacth uploading utility to get the backup content right back on

Next in line, document change history and favorite documents

Status Update

March 5, 2007 on 10:29 pm | In iQuickdoc, Micro ISV, Micro ISV in India | No Comments

After a strenous week! Here is a short update on what is going on in iQuickdoc. I have been deep into executing the promised features for the upcoming release and they are shaping up real well. iQuickdoc now has

1. Full folder support

2. Configurable page results

3. Remember’s the project opened per session so you need not choose again after navigating to any other page

4. Downloading documents now shows a ‘open or save’ dialog without the additional browser window that used to open before

And a few more minor refinements. Now, I am going on to providing batch update of documents.
